The Importance of Self-Care in the Workplace

Understanding the Risks of Burnout

Burnout is a state of emotional, mental, and physical exhaustion caused by prolonged stress, overwork, and lack of balance in life. It can lead to decreased productivity, absenteeism, and turnover. In today’s fast-paced work environment, it’s easy to get caught up in the pressure to perform and neglect our own well-being. * Recognizing the signs of burnout: feeling drained, depleted, and exhausted; lack of motivation and interest in work; reduced productivity and performance; and increased absenteeism and turnover.**

The Benefits of Self-Care in the Workplace

Incorporating self-care practices into the workplace can have numerous benefits, including:

  • Improved mental health: reducing stress and anxiety; promoting relaxation and calmness; and improving overall well-being. Increased productivity: improved focus and concentration; enhanced creativity and problem-solving skills; and increased job satisfaction.

    The Impact of Poor Work Environments on Employee Well-being

    Physical Health Consequences

  • Ergonomic issues: Poorly designed workspaces can lead to musculoskeletal disorders, such as back pain and carpal tunnel syndrome. Eye strain and vision problems: Inadequate lighting and poor display settings can cause eye fatigue, headaches, and vision problems. Respiratory issues: Dusty or poorly ventilated workspaces can exacerbate respiratory conditions, such as asthma. ### Mental Health Consequences**
  • Mental Health Consequences

  • Anxiety and depression: Chronic stress and poor work environments can contribute to the development of anxiety and depression.
